Bitwarden is an open source password manager that helps users store, generate, and manage passwords securely. It has cross-platform apps with end-to-end encryption and support for auto-fill to make logging into sites and apps easy.

Elixir is a modern, functional, concurrent programming language built on top of the Erlang VM. It takes advantages of Erlang's rock-solid fault-tolerance and scalability while also introducing cleaner and more maintainable syntax. Elixir is well-suited for building distributed, fault-tolerant applications.
